数据库 · 9 11 月, 2024

深入理解數據庫原理,提升應用實踐能力——推薦優秀的數據庫原理及應用書籍(數據庫原理及應用的書)

深入理解數據庫原理,提升應用實踐能力——推薦優秀的數據庫原理及應用書籍

在當今數據驅動的世界中,數據庫的使用已成為各行各業不可或缺的一部分。無論是企業管理、電子商務還是社交媒體,數據庫都在背後支持著各種應用的運行。因此,深入理解數據庫的原理及其應用,對於開發者和數據分析師來說,都是一項重要的技能。

數據庫的基本原理

數據庫是一種有組織的數據集合,通常由數據庫管理系統(DBMS)來管理。數據庫的基本原理包括數據的存儲、檢索、更新和管理。數據庫的設計通常遵循一定的模型,如關係模型、文檔模型和圖模型等。

  • 關係模型:這是最常見的數據庫模型,數據以表格的形式存儲,表格之間可以通過鍵(Key)進行關聯。
  • 文檔模型:這種模型通常用於NoSQL數據庫,數據以文檔的形式存儲,適合處理非結構化數據。
  • 圖模型:這種模型專注於數據之間的關係,適合社交網絡和推薦系統等應用。

數據庫的應用實踐

在實際應用中,數據庫的選擇和設計對於系統的性能和可擴展性至關重要。開發者需要根據具體需求選擇合適的數據庫類型,並設計合理的數據結構。例如,在一個電子商務平台中,可能需要設計用戶、產品和訂單等多個表格,並通過外鍵來建立它們之間的關聯。

數據庫性能優化

數據庫性能優化是提升應用實踐能力的重要一環。常見的優化方法包括:

  • 索引:通過為表格創建索引,可以加快數據檢索的速度。
  • 查詢優化:對SQL查詢進行優化,減少不必要的計算和數據傳輸。
  • 分區:將大型表格分區,可以提高查詢效率和數據管理的靈活性。

推薦書籍

為了深入理解數據庫原理及其應用,以下是幾本值得推薦的書籍:

  • 《SQL必知必會》:這本書適合初學者,通過簡單易懂的語言介紹了SQL的基本概念和用法。
  • 《數據庫系統概念》:這本書深入探討了數據庫的理論基礎,適合有一定基礎的讀者。
  • 《高性能MySQL》:這本書專注於MySQL的性能優化,適合希望提升數據庫性能的開發者。
  • 《NoSQL精粹》:這本書介紹了NoSQL數據庫的基本概念和應用場景,適合對新興技術感興趣的讀者。

結論

深入理解數據庫原理不僅能提升開發者的技術能力,還能幫助企業更好地管理和利用數據。通過學習相關書籍和實踐應用,開發者可以在數據庫設計和管理上獲得更深入的見解,從而提升整體的應用實踐能力。

如果您對於數據庫的運用有進一步的需求,無論是尋找合適的 VPS 解決方案,還是需要高效的 香港伺服器 來支持您的應用,Server.HK 都能提供專業的服務和支持。